I stopped by Topcon’s Fort Atkinson, Wis., facility this week to check in with the precision technology manufacturer and get a feel for the company’s outlook on the precision market.
A large percentage of what is manufactured at the Fort Atkinson plant is headed to OEM customers, says Travis Brueske. He is hopeful that we’ll start to see the ag economy stabilize in the second half of 2026.
“When I look at the market as a whole specifically for agriculture, I am starting to get a sense that we've at least plateaued and I believe plateauing in the sense of we're starting to see an increase or at least some uptick in the frequency of orders coming in from our customers. That's both OEMs and also aftermarket dealerships that we supply here out of this location. Hopefully that trend continues. I wouldn't say it's on a rocket ship. You know what? Going in this direction, we're starting to see some peaks and some valleys, but we're definitely not in that trough anymore.”
“My guess, and my hope is by the end of next year we start to see the new normal. What is that new normal going to look like? I'm not sure, but hopefully getting back to some resemblance of the pre-pandemic type volumes and numbers that we were seeing. To make sure that we're ready for when that happens in any way, shape, or form, we're really focusing here at Topcon on our infrastructure. We are looking at how we're doing things from a process and workflow perspective, and we're looking to see where things like automation potentially could play into what we are doing. We're looking at things like AI, especially on the logistics side of the business, especially for the things that my team is looking at. Because at the end of the day, whatever it comes back to look like, we have to be ready not only to supply a product, but also to support that product that we are selling. And we think by streamlining what we do, that's one positive way to do that.”
